    FRANCE: FLOAT GLASS MARKET, BY END-USE INDUSTRY, 2025–2030

    Segment202520262027202820292030CAGR (%)
    AUTOMOTIVE & TRANSPORTATION2084.92289.32513.62759.93030.43327.49.8
    CONSTRUCTION & INFRASTRUCTURE4892.953485845.363896983.17632.69.3
    OTHER END-USE INDUSTRIES348.6379.3412.6449488.5531.48.8
    SOLAR ENERGY837.51049.413151647.62064.52586.825.3
    TOTAL81649065.910086.511245.512566.514078.211.5

    Market Definition

    Float glass is a flat glass product created by spreading molten glass into a controlled, continuous layer so that it naturally levels and solidifies into a smooth, uniform sheet. The process ensures consistent thickness and surface quality without the need for mechanical polishing. Float glass functions as the fundamental glass form from which performance-enhanced products such as safety, coated, and insulated glass are developed for use in buildings, vehicles, energy systems, and specialized industrial applications.
